Abstract: | ![]() Polyvinylpolysilsesquioxane (PVPS) organic-inorganic hybrid gel films containing polyethylene and siloxane backbone linkages were prepared through the radical polymerization of trimethoxy(vinyl)silane (VTS) followed by the acid-catalyzed hydrolytic polycondensation of trimethoxysilyl groups. The PVPS gel films were transparent and homogeneous. It was found that the mechanical properties of these films correlate both to the degrees of polymerization and to the extent of cross linking. |
